2008 Scion xB.
MPG readout is pretty accurate VS calculated at pump. Mostly country back roads, and some idling here and there. Not bad for a Camry 2.4L pushing a refrigerator through space & time.

At 227k the oil consumption is 1qt/4K miles. Using VRP 5W-30 to hopefully fix that. Although this consumption rate isn't bad at all for a 2AZ-FE, all things considered. May not even need a B12 Piston Soak.

Is that a ScanGauge3? If so, how do you like it?
It is! It's nice to have because the Honda Fit has no temp gauge.... No other auxiliary gauges either so I use the scangauge to monitor coolant temp and volts. Plus whatever else I feel like watching like spark advance and catalyst temp LOL.
